FDA Device recall Z-1499-2015

CROSSCHECK(R) Plating system, Utility Plate, 7-Hole, REF CCP-UTN7. Orthopedic use

On 2015-04-29 the FDA classified a Class II recall of CROSSCHECK(R) Plating system, Utility Plate, 7-Hole, REF CCP-UTN7. Orthopedic use by Wright Medical Technology, citing the minor diameter, major diameter, thread pitch, and pitch on the Crosscheck are out of specification, which may result in intraoperative malfunction.
